MARK SHEDIAC

SECURITIES LENDING MANAGER

Mark is a Securities Lending Manager at The Terra Fund, where his experience encompasses multiple aspects, including ensuring smooth and effective operations of lending services, supporting business goals and budgeting. At Terra, his work includes analyzing risk metrics, forecasting collateral trade information, supporting daily trading of assets where they meet the fund’s criteria to ensure protocols and guidelines are being met within the fund structure. His key skills as a securities lending manager is to appropriately reduce risks when possible, so business decisions are made to meet expansion as well as predicting securities hedging risks involved in lending for worldwide markets.

Mark originally started his career at State Street Bank as a global securities lending associate, were he managed cash and non–cash collateral, trained and supervised new recruits and fostered key relationships with brokers, traders and custodians. He was later promoted to a senior portfolio accountant role where he oversaw day–to–day operations for a multibillion dollar pension fund and presented monthly financial statements with daily net asset value pricing. He later joined the team of Barclays Global Investors as a senior securities lending product services analyst where his responsibilities included resolving operational issues, identifying new opportunities and supported strategic relations with counterparties.

After Barclays, he moved to Morgan Stanley Prime Brokerage as a client service associate, where he secured, developed and serviced business relationships with hedge funds, cross–sold firm products and services to clients to maximize earnings and minimize risks. Furthermore, he managed point of contact for seven hedge funds and mitigated risk for clients by focusing more on compliance, controls and knowledge within hedge funds to comply with safety measures for transparent transactions. He would later on become an associate at Harvest Capital Strategies and Ascent Capital were his main tasks included importing market positions on a daily basis, conduct in–depth quantitative and qualitative research on the private impact investing market and assist with review of marketing reports.

Mark received a Bachelor’s degree in Economics and Geography from Cark University in Atlanta, Georgia, where he also sang in the acapella group unassisted by musical instruments, through the University’s acapella club, The Clark Bar.
